Subject: DR Drill — SDK Parity Check. Team, next Thursday we run the quarterly disaster-recovery drill for the Emberline platform. Part of the drill verifies feature parity between the Kestrel (mobile) and Tarn (web) client SDKs after failover, since last quarter the retry logic diverged. Support should log any parity gaps in the drill tracker as they appear. To access the standby environment during the drill, each agent authenticates once with the drill recovery passphrase listed below.

recovery phrase for fajep-yaweg: gilath-sorox-wenius-rusdor-keliel-zorius

Hey Marisol,

Handing over the nightly search reindex before I'm out next week. Short version: the job pulls from the catalog tables, rebuilds the Lexiq index, then swaps aliases around 02:30. If it overruns past 04:00, the morning cache warmers collide with it — just kill and rerun after 06:00, it's idempotent. The reviewer asked about the swap logic; it's all in `reindex/swap.py`, nothing fancy. The job reads its source data through the following:

replica DSN, kajep-yahag: mssql://praok_svc:iF@db-8d68.plorvaio.local:5432/eliion

Handover for Wednesday's sync: the Quillpress invoice renderer now embeds fonts at build time rather than fetching them per render, which fixed the blank-glyph reports from the Harlow rollout. Pagination of multi-page line items still truncates at 400 rows — ticket filed, not urgent. Tomas owns it after this week. For reference, the renderer currently runs with the following configuration:

service settings:
PRAIX_LOG_LEVEL=error
PRAIX_METRICS_HOST=metrics.praix.qorvelcorp.corp
PRAIX_POOL_SIZE=16